Cheesy Chicken Spaghetti Bake with Pimento and White Wine

Serving Size: 8

Cooking Time: 80 minutes

Ingredients

  • 8 Ounces (oz) spaghetti, divided
  • 3 Cups chicken meat, cubed
  • 2 Cups Cheddar cheese, divided
  • 10.5 Ounces (oz) can condensed cream of mushroom soup
  • 0.5 Cups onion, minced
  • 0.25 Cups pimento peppers, minced
  • 0.25 Cups green bell pepper, minced
  • 0.25 Cups white wine
  • 1 Pinch salt, to taste
  • 1 Pinch pepper, to taste
  • 2 Tablespoons (tbsp) unsalted butter
  • 2 Cloves garlic, minced
  • 0.5 Teaspoons (tsp) smoked paprika
  • 0.5 Teaspoons (tsp) dried thyme

Steps

  1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  2.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Cook the spaghetti in the boiling water, stirring occasionally, until al dente, about 10 to 12 minutes. Drain and set aside.
  3. In a large skillet,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the minced garlic and sauté until fragrant, about 1 minute. Add the minced onion, green bell pepper, and pimento peppers. Cook until the vegetables are softened, about 5 minutes.
  4. In a large bowl, combine the cooked spaghetti, cubed chicken, 1.5 cups of Cheddar cheese, condensed soup, sautéed vegetables, white wine, smoked paprika, dried thyme, salt, and pepper. Mix until well combined.
  5. Spread the mixture into a 9x13-inch baking dish.
  6. Bake in the preheated oven for 30 minutes.
  7. Sprinkle the remaining 0.5 cup of Cheddar cheese over the casserole and bake until the cheese is melted and bubbly, about 15 minutes longer.
  8. Let the casserole rest for 5 minutes before serving. Enjoy your savory creation!
